Form categories allow you to group related forms according to your business requirements. For example, all forms associated with hiring a new employee can be grouped into a category called "New Employees." Then, when reviewing submitted forms and signed forms, your search criteria can be narrowed down to the "New Employees" category of forms.
Categorizing your forms is a simple yet powerful method of managing a library of forms and is used throughout Formatta E-Forms Manager. When a form is initially uploaded using the New Form screen, you will assign it to a Form Category. Throughout the form catalog, and when working with submitted forms and data, you will refine searches based on form categories. Further, whether or not forms appear in the Available Forms screen when published, and how they are presented on that screen, is managed by category.
Select Categories from the Administration tab to display and edit a list of form categories.
The Form Categories screen allows you to review, create, and manage categories of forms in Formatta E-Forms Manager. The list of form categories shows:
Category Name - A name created by a Form Administrator for categorizing forms. The category name is up to your discretion but should be descriptive. Once a category is created, it can be edited and changed but not deleted.
Status - Categories can be either be enabled or disabled. If a category is disabled, no new forms can be assigned to that category. However, forms published under a disabled category will still be available to end users to fill out, sign, and submit.
Edit - Allows you to edit a specific form category.
To view specific details about a form category, click on the corresponding row in the Form Categories screen. The Category Details screen displays with the following details:
Category Name: The name of the form category.
Status: Whether or not the category is enabled or disabled.
Published Forms List: Whether or not forms assigned to this category are allowed to appear on the catalog's published forms list when published.
Last Updated: The date and time the form category was edited by a form administrator.
Last Updated By: The name of the form administrator who last edited the form category.
To edit this form category, select "Edit Category." Choose "Back to List" to return to the Form Categories screen.
Select "Edit" corresponding to the category you want to change. The Edit Form Category screen displays with the following options:
Category Name: The name of the form category can be changed, and all forms associated with the category will be updated with the new category name.
Enabled: If this box is checked, new forms can be assigned to this category. If the box is not checked, new forms cannot be assigned to this category. All published forms will still be available to end users regardless of whether the category is enabled or disabled; that is, the checkbox applies only to forms that will be uploaded in the future.
Published Forms List: Whether or not forms in this category will appear (when published) in the published form list. If this is turned off, then forms in this category will never appear in public lists of published forms or in search results from the published forms pages.
Select "New Category" to display the Create Form Category screen and create a new form category. Two options are available:
Category Name: Enter an appropriate name for the category of forms you'll be uploading. Examples include Human Resources, Immigration, New Hire, Insurance, etc.
Enabled: Use the checkbox to allow forms to be assigned to this category.
Published Forms List: Check this box to allow forms assigned to this category to show up in the published form list. If this is turned off, then forms in this category will never appear in public lists of published forms or in search results from the published forms pages.
Form categories can be sorted using the dropdown box on the Form Categories screen. Three options are available:
Enabled - Show only categories of forms that can be assigned to new, future forms.
Disabled - Show only categories of forms that are disabled; that is, categories of forms that are not available when new forms are uploaded to Formatta E-Forms Manager.
Show All - Show both enabled and disabled form categories.
